MiMo Code, an open-source signal monitoring tool for AI operations, has been officially released, targeting operations leaders managing AI tool rollouts in small teams. This development aims to address the challenge of tracking fast-moving AI capability and policy shifts relevant to specific roles, providing a filtered, timely brief on impactful changes.
The MiMo Code project was launched by IdeaNavigator AI to offer a focused, role-specific monitoring solution. It scans feeds like Hacker News and similar platforms, filtering for AI capability and policy shifts that matter to operations leads overseeing AI deployment. Impact of MiMo Code on AI Operations Management
The release of MiMo Code addresses a critical need for timely, role-specific intelligence in AI deployment. As AI capabilities and policies evolve rapidly, operations leaders often struggle to stay informed and react promptly. This tool offers a practical solution to filter relevant information from broad, noisy sources, potentially reducing decision delays and improving deployment strategies. Its open-source nature encourages community engagement, customization, and broader adoption, which could shape how small teams manage AI risks and opportunities.

Key Questions
How does MiMo Code filter relevant AI developments?
It scans feeds like Hacker News and similar sources, applying filters to identify updates related to AI capabilities and policies that impact small team operations.
Is MiMo Code available for anyone to use?
Yes, it is released as an open-source project, allowing organizations and developers to customize and deploy it according to their needs.
What kind of organizations will benefit most from MiMo Code?
Small teams managing AI tool deployment, especially operations leads seeking quick, role-specific updates on AI developments.
Can MiMo Code be integrated with existing monitoring tools?
Details are still emerging, but the open-source nature suggests potential for integration and customization based on user requirements.
What are the limitations of MiMo Code at this stage?
Its effectiveness depends on user feedback, and its current scope is narrow, focusing primarily on early signals from specific feeds without extensive customization options yet.
